Samwu is pursuing a R9. 6 million claim against former deputy general secretary Moses Miya, who is accused of embezzling funds during his tenure.

A former leader of Samwu is facing a lawsuit from the organisation to repay millions of rand. Picture: Jacques Naude / Independent NewspapersTHE SA Municipal Workers’ Union wants to over R9.6 million from its former deputy general secretary Moses Miya, who is accused of stealing the money over three years.

The union later instituted an action in the Free State High Court against Miya for the payment of R9.6m. Two weeks ago, Judge Joseph Mhlambi found that the Free State High Court has no jurisdiction to entertain Samwu’s action.The basis of Miya’s special plea on jurisdiction was that he was based in Gauteng whereas the union filed its bid to recover the millions in the Free State, where his wife lived.In addition, Miya said Samwu sought an order directing Old Mutual Super Fund Pension Fund to deduct certain monies from his pension benefit.

Miya could not be reached for comment this week but Samwu’s current general secretary Dumisane Magagula said the union had received the high court ruling on jurisdiction.
